Understanding the World Series Schedule
The World Series schedule is like a carefully crafted roadmap leading to the ultimate showdown in baseball. Typically, it follows a 2-3-2 format. This means the first two games are played at the home stadium of the team with the better regular-season record. Then, the series shifts to the other team's home field for the next three games, if necessary. Finally, if Games Six and Seven are needed, they return to the initial team's stadium. This arrangement aims to balance home-field advantage, creating an exciting and strategically interesting series. It’s also worth noting that travel days are built into the schedule to allow teams to move between cities, ensuring players get adequate rest and can perform at their best. Keep an eye on official announcements from Major League Baseball (MLB) for the definitive schedule, as unforeseen circumstances like weather can sometimes cause adjustments. Understanding this structure helps you anticipate when Game Three will be played and plan accordingly. What to Expect in Game Three
Game Three is often a pivotal moment in the World Series. After the first two games, teams have a better sense of their opponent's strengths and weaknesses. Game Three is where adjustments are typically made, both in terms of strategy and player matchups. Expect to see tactical changes in pitching, batting orders, and defensive alignments. The atmosphere is also electric, especially if it's the first home game for one of the teams. The crowd's energy can significantly impact the players' performance, adding an extra layer of excitement to the game. It's also common to see a different starting pitcher for each team, bringing new dynamics to the mound. Keep an eye on key players who might step up and become game-changers. Game Three often sets the tone for the rest of the series, making it a must-watch event for any baseball fan.
